Steps

  1. 1Combine grated ginger, soy sauce, mirin, sake, and sugar in a bowl to make the marinade.
  2. 2Dip each slice of pork into the ginger marinade, ensuring it's well coated.
  3. 3Heat vegetable o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at and quickly pan-fry the marinated pork slices in batches until cooked through and slightly caramelized.
  4. 4Serve the hot ginger pork immediately with shredded cabbage and a side of rice.
